About this tag
The ai operating layer tag on WindowsForum.com covers discussions about AI assistants like Microsoft Copilot and Google Gemini that are becoming foundational components embedded deeply within productivity, enterprise, creative, and everyday consumer workflows. These AI systems are no longer mere add-ons but serve as the interface for modern work, data analysis, and organization. The tag explores how these AI operating layers are transforming tasks and competing to redefine user interaction with technology, particularly in the context of Windows and Microsoft ecosystems.
